Actually all feelings are valid, but feelings are only a signal that something is out of balance within you. Assignment of meaning/cause to feelings is where you can be correct or incorrect.

This is a good take but I wouldn't necessarily say out of balance. They're more like a sign that pops up that points toward survival. That mechanism can be hacked ie you can feel something based on deception or a mistake, but at their core it's just biology pushing you towards or away things that do you good or harm. Our higher intellect is basically an override switch that lets us ignore them as needed and figure out when they might do us a disservice.

This helps explain why people who are highly cerebral sometimes have problems in life, and especially their social lives. When you can easily put feelings at a low volume it's easy to discount their importance and ignore them as uncomfortable quirks of being human, rather than important signs that are extremely useful for navigating all kinds of relationships and life in general.

Midwits who are intelligent enough to control their impulses, but not so brainy that they are still forced to experience them loud and clear don't have this problem. But I think anyone can still pay close attention and get the same benefits once you understand this is how it's supposed to work. Just takes a perspective shift.
